Valoarea optimă a mtu. Dimensiunea optimă a MTU - reduce încărcarea rețelei

În momentul în care gazda trebuie să transmită date prin interfață, se referă la dimensiunea maximă a blocului de date util pentru un pachet Unitate de transmisie maximă, pentru a determina câte date poate încadra în fiecare pachet. De exemplu, interfețele Ethernet au un MTU implicit de 1500 de octeți, fără a include antetul sau trailerul Ethernet. Aceasta înseamnă că o gazdă care trebuie să trimită date prin TCP va folosi de obicei primii 20 dintre acești 1500 de octeți pentru antetul IP, următorii 20 pentru antetul TCP și restul de 1460 de octeți pentru încărcătura utilă. Încapsularea datelor în pachete de dimensiune maximă astfel permite cel mai eficient consum de lățime de bandă, minimizând în același timp utilizarea supraîncărcării protocolului de date. Dimensiunea optimă a MTU este cheia pentru utilizarea eficientă a canalelor de date din rețea și reducerea sarcinii echipamentelor de rețea.

Din păcate, nu toate dispozitivele de pe Internet au aceeași dimensiune maximă MTU. MTU poate diferi în funcție de tipul de suport fizic sau de încapsularea configurată (de exemplu, tunelul GRE sau criptarea IPsec). Când un router decide să redirecționeze un pachet IPv4 printr-o interfață și determină că dimensiunea pachetului depășește MTU-ul interfeței, routerul TREBUIE să împartă pachetul astfel încât să fie trimis în două (sau mai multe) părți separate, fiecare dintre ele nu depășind limită MTU de legătură între abonați. Fragmentarea este destul de costisitoare, atât în ​​ceea ce privește resursele routerului, cât și utilizarea lățimii de bandă. Trebuie create titluri noi și atașate fiecărui fragment. În specificația protocolului IPv6, fragmentarea pachetelor este complet eliminată de la router, dar acesta este un subiect pentru o discuție separată.

Determinarea dimensiunii MTU optime a unui pachet de date

Pentru a utiliza legătura în cel mai eficient mod, gazdele trebuie să determine dimensiunea MTU optimă - aceasta este MTU minimă dintre toate nodurile de pe calea dintre gazde. De exemplu, pentru două gazde, calea între care constă din 3 routere cu diferite dimensiuni de pachete maxime posibile: 1500, 800 și 1200 de octeți, fiecare dintre gazdele finale trebuie să accepte cea mai mică dimensiune de pachet de 800 de octeți pentru a evita fragmentarea.

Nu fragmentați și destinația inaccesabilă, fragmentarea este necesară

Pachetele se pot muta aleatoriu prin rețele și nu este posibil să se precalculeze toate rutele și dimensiunile maxime ale pachetelor pentru fiecare conexiune. RFC 1191 specifică o metodologie pentru determinarea mărimii MTU. Procesul prin care o gazdă pentru o anumită conexiune poate detecta un MTU mai mic decât o acceptă propria interfață de rețea. Două componente sunt cheie: bitul Nu fragmentați (DF) din antetul IP și subcodul mesajului ICMP Destinație inaccesabilă, fragmentare necesară.

Setarea bitului DF pe un pachet IP previne fragmentarea routerului atunci când detectează un MTU mai mic decât dimensiunea pachetului. În schimb, pachetul este abandonat și expeditorul primește un mesaj prin ICMP despre necesitatea fragmentării pachetului. În esență, routerul indică faptul că trebuie să împartă pachetul pentru a-l trimite mai departe, dar indicatorul Don’t Fragment (DF) îl împiedică să facă acest lucru. RFC 1191 extinde mesajul de solicitare a fragmentului ICMP pentru a include dimensiunea MTU pentru conexiunea curentă.

Acum că dimensiunea maximă a pachetului pentru o conexiune a fost descoperită, gazda poate stoca această valoare în cache și poate genera altele ulterioare de dimensiunea corespunzătoare. Rețineți că descoperirea dimensiunii maxime a pachetului pentru o anumită conexiune este un proces în desfășurare. În cazul utilizării rutei dinamice și reconstrucției rutei dintre emițător și receptor, gazda continuă să încerce periodic să seteze steag-ul DF pentru a detecta o reducere suplimentară a dimensiunii pachetului. RFC 1191 vă permite, de asemenea, să testați periodic posibilitatea de a crește dimensiunea maximă a pachetului pentru fiecare rută, încercând uneori să transmiteți un pachet mai mare decât cel din cache. Dacă pachetul este transmis cu succes, atunci valoarea limitei de dimensiune a pachetului este crescută.

MTU în router, ce este și de ce viteza conexiunii dvs. la Internet depinde de acest parametru? Descrierea detaliată a parametrului rețelei mtu, caracteristicile și proprietățile acestuia. Articolul oferă instrucțiuni pentru determinarea și modificarea corectă a setărilor mtu într-un router wi-fi.

MTU (nivel maxim de transmisie în rețea -unitate de transmisie maximă (MTU)) este un protocol de nivel de legătură care definește cel mai mare număr de blocuri „utile” de biți într-un singur pachet de rețea. După cum știți, schimbul de informații între server și client (furnizor și utilizator) este posibil datorită transferului de pachete de date individuale.

Aceste pachete formează seturi de blocuri utile. Ca urmare a utilizării unui protocol securizat, informațiile din pachet sunt transmise fără fragmentare, ceea ce vă permite, la rândul său, să accelerați schimbul de date în rețeaua globală.

Cu cuvinte simple, MTU este necesar pentru a asigura funcționarea stabilă a Internetului pe computer. Setând valoarea corectă, puteți obține o viteză excelentă cu întreruperi minime.

De ce să limitați MTU?

Acest protocol de nivel de legătură este supus unei restricții obligatorii. Acest lucru se face prin alocarea unei anumite valori numerice lui mtu. Această acțiune este necesară pentru atingerea următoarelor obiective:

  1. Distribuția rațională a sarcinii între blocurile de transmisie și recepție a informațiilor în rețea;
  2. Reducerea sarcinii totale. Acest lucru va reduce, de asemenea, timpul de transmitere a informațiilor;
  3. Extensii de canal de transmisie. Astfel, va putea folosi mai multe aplicații, servicii și procese în același timp;
  4. Creșteți răspunsul rețelei. Ca rezultat, rețeaua va funcționa mai eficient, iar probabilitatea pachetelor de date „spărute” (care nu s-au recuperat) este redusă la minimum.

Găsirea dimensiunii MTU corecte pentru rețea

Adesea, utilizatorii de tp-link, d-link, asus și alte routere au valoarea mtu greșită în setările routerului. Acest lucru poate duce la:

  • Probleme cu redarea în flux video;
  • Erori la descărcarea fișierelor;
  • Certificate de securitate expirate pentru unele site-uri;
  • Internet lent general.

Orez. 1 - Probleme de internet

Dacă descoperiți că recent conexiunea la rețea a devenit prea lentă și site-urile obișnuite nu se mai deschid sau se încarcă „etern”, trebuie să configurați mtu. Calculatorul client nu poate deschide site-ul dacă valoarea mtu este mai mare decât valoarea maximă a pachetului de date care este trimis prin protocol.

Citiți mai multe despre configurarea unei varietăți de routere în materialul nostru: Cum să introduceți setările routerului - TP-Link, D-Link, Asus, Zyxel Keenetic, Rostelecom

Fiecare router poate schimba automat numărul mtu. Uneori, această caracteristică nu funcționează în favoarea vitezei rețelei, așa că puteți modifica manual valoarea. Puteți determina numărul „ideal” de mtu folosind un test numit Ping Test .

Ping (ping - întârziere) este timpul necesar pentru ca un pachet de date trimis de pe computer să călătorească la un alt computer (sau server) și să se întoarcă înapoi la computerul de pe care a fost trimis.

În timpul testului ping, ar trebui să trimiteți solicitări repetate, reducând periodic dimensiunea pachetului de date. Acest lucru trebuie făcut până când fragmentarea pachetului se oprește complet. Ca rezultat, veți afla cel mai precis număr de mtu care este necesar pentru funcționarea rapidă a unei anumite rețele.

Proces de testare:

  • Accesați linia de comandă;
  • Introduceți comanda prezentată în figura de mai jos pentru a vă conecta la domeniu;

Orez. 2 - conexiune la domeniul de testare

Înștiințare! XXXX este valoarea MTU. În timpul testării, modificați-l în intervalul de la 1500 la 500 în trepte de 10 octeți. Un rezultat de succes este atunci când procentul de pierderi nu depășește 1%.

  • Ca urmare a executării corecte a comenzii, vor apărea linii cu statistici ping (numărul de pachete trimise și primite, timpul aproximativ de transmitere a acestora în milisecunde, procentul de pierderi);

Orez. 3 - rezultatul unei comenzi reușite

  • Acum ar trebui să repetați din nou aceeași comandă. Faceți-o sărind o linie;
  • Repetați testul de fiecare dată cu o nouă valoare mtu până când obțineți cel mai bun rezultat de transmisie de pachete cu cel mai mic procent de pierdere de pachete. Amintiți-vă numerele mtu - aceasta este valoarea de care vom avea nevoie în configurația mtu ulterioară.

Orez. 4 - cea mai bună valoare pentru MTU găsită ca rezultat al testării

Schimbarea MTU în router

Utilizatorii routerului pot schimba în mod independent toate setările de conexiune și funcționarea wi-fi în rețeaua globală. Pentru a face acest lucru, accesați meniul de configurare. Deschideți orice browser instalat pe computer și introduceți adresa IP locală 192.168.0.1 în bara de adrese, apăsați Enter.

În caseta de dialog care se deschide, va apărea un formular pentru introducerea numelui de autentificare și a parolei administratorului PC-ului. În ambele câmpuri, scrieți cuvântul admin sau alte date de conectare la rețea (le puteți citi în instrucțiunile pentru router sau întrebați furnizorul). Așteptați autorizarea.

Fereastra de setări a fiecărui model de router poate avea o diferență externă, cu toate acestea, structura câmpurilor este practic aceeași. Mai întâi trebuie să decideți asupra valorii finale a mtu. Luați rezultatul obținut în timpul procesului de testare. În cazul nostru, acesta este de 1458 de biți și adăugați încă 28 de biți. Octeții suplimentari sunt locul pentru anteturile pachetului și cererii. Ca rezultat, obținem 1458+28 = 1486 octeți pentru mtu.

Pentru routere TP-Link

Pentru a schimba mtu, faceți clic pe elementul de meniu „Rețea”. Apoi, în partea dreaptă a ferestrei, găsiți câmpul mtu și introduceți valoarea necesară, așa cum se arată în figură:

Pentru Asus

Faceți clic pe fila de setări avansate. Apoi pe „WAN”:

Alte modele de router sunt configurate într-un mod similar. Parametrul se află în fila „WAN” sau „Rețea”.

Anulați configurația

Ce să faci când pui o valoare greșită? Dacă setările sunt setate incorect, utilizarea internetului va fi însoțită de eșecuri și încetiniri și mai mari.

Pentru a reseta modificările efectuate, accesați setările routerului și schimbați din nou mtu-ul manual. Luați în considerare valoarea optimă în funcție de protocolul de transfer de date utilizat pe computer:

  • Pentru protocolul PPPoE, valoarea normală va fi 1420;
  • IP dinamic/static - 1500;
  • L2TP-1460.
Tine minte! Numărul de mtu nu trebuie să fie mai mare decât valoarea optimă.

Peste 90% dintre computerele utilizatorilor folosesc IP dinamic/static. Vă sfătuim să aflați exact tipul de protocol, în setările routerului, faceți următoarele:

  1. Faceți clic pe fila „Configurare rapidă”;
  2. Apoi pe „Detecția automată a tipului de conexiune” și „Următorul”;

  1. Așteptați până când sistemul alege singur opțiunea corectă;
  2. Priviți ce tip de conexiune a fost detectat și setați valoarea optimă în setări pe baza numerelor indicate în lista anterioară.

După finalizarea instalării, reporniți computerul și conexiunea WAN a acestuia. Dacă problemele de internet persistă, contactați furnizorul de servicii de internet pentru sfaturi individuale. Problema poate apărea și de partea furnizorului de servicii.

Creșteți viteza internetului prin schimbarea MTU și DNS

MTU în router - ce este? Creștem viteza internetului

Numărul MTU este pachetul maxim de date transmis care este trimis de la server la echipament. Este folosit în conexiunea la Internet și îi afectează direct viteza. Cum funcționează MTU? Pentru a transfera conexiunea rapid și eficient, datele sunt transferate nu pe un octet, ci prin pachete întregi. Computerul despachetează pachetul și descarcă informații precum o pagină web, un joc etc.

Puțini utilizatori obișnuiți s-au întrebat ce este MTU și de ce este indicat în setări

De ce merită să verificați și să schimbați un astfel de parametru? Se întâmplă adesea ca utilizatorul să se conecteze la Internet și, deși viteza de conectare declarată ar trebui să fie mare, browserul încarcă site-ul sau jocul lent, sau nu dorește deloc să acceseze unele pagini. În același timp, internetul nu dispare în întregime, dar încărcarea slabă se referă la site-uri sau aplicații individuale.

Pentru a rezolva problema, se recomandă să vă schimbați setările DNS. Puteți face acest lucru prin Panoul de control. Deschideți secțiunea cu conexiuni la internet, selectați rețeaua și vizualizați proprietățile acesteia. În ele veți găsi componente, printre care ar trebui să selectați protocolul Internet TCP / IP și să introduceți manual adresele DNS - 8.8.8.8 și în a doua linie 8.8.4.4.

Dacă ați încercat să modificați valoarea DNS, dar nu a ajutat, ar trebui să vă referiți la setările pentru dimensiunea pachetului de date. Când furnizorul are un număr din acest set de parametri, iar routerul dvs. are alt număr, viteza scade și conexiunea nu funcționează bine. Pe computer, nu trebuie să îl schimbați, deoarece în cele mai recente versiuni de Windows, sistemul însuși determină valoarea optimă pentru funcționarea în rețea.

Cum să aflați ce MTU să setați pe router?

Există valori standard pentru acest parametru pentru routere. În cele mai multe cazuri, este folosit numărul 1500 - este implicit de bază, folosit pentru adrese IP dinamice și statice.

Pentru o conexiune L2TP, este selectat numărul 1460, iar pentru PPPoE - 1420. Merită să încercați combinația 1476 - este setată implicit pentru rețelele de tip 3G.

O altă opțiune prin care puteți afla combinația corectă de dimensiune de transfer de pachete pentru routerul dvs. este să sunați la centrul de servicii al ISP-ului dumneavoastră. Vă vor furniza date exacte, dar este posibil să nu vă poată răspunde solicitării, așa că merită să învățați cum să determinați singur acest număr.

Acest lucru se poate face verificând valoarea MTU setată pe computer și router. Dacă nu se potrivesc, acesta este motivul pentru viteza slabă a conexiunii. Pentru a afla combinația pe un computer, procedați în felul următor:

  • Introduceți linia PING -f -l 1472 xxx.xxx.xxx.xxx în Total Commander, unde, în loc de cruci, introduceți adresa IP.
  • Dacă rezultatul este textul „Răspuns de la...”, atunci numărul MTU corect este 1500, așa cum ar trebui să fie implicit. De ce 1472? Kiloocteții rămași sunt octeți de sistem și sunt adăugați automat la acest număr pentru a obține un total de 1500.
  • Dacă textul „Pachetul trebuie fragmentat, dar DF ​​setat” a apărut ca răspuns la comandă, trebuie să căutați manual valoarea corectă reducând numărul 1472 cu zeci până când aveți linia „Răspuns de la...”. Apoi, la valoarea finală trebuie adăugați 28 de kiloocteți de sistem, obținând numărul corect.

Setarea MTU în router

După ce ați aflat combinația necesară pentru pachetul de date maxim transmis, introduceți-o în parametrii routerului.

Acest lucru se face în felul următor:

  • Accesați setările routerului dvs. În linia browser, introduceți adresa IP a echipamentului, în fereastra care apare, introduceți login-ul și parola (dacă nu le-ați schimbat, utilizați cuvântul Admin în ambele rânduri).
  • Selectați secțiunea Rețea, deschideți meniul WAN.
  • Introduceți numărul necesar în linia MTU Size, salvați modificările și reporniți echipamentul.

Unii oameni folosesc VPN-uri pentru a accesa site-uri web blocate, în timp ce alții ocolesc pur și simplu restricțiile geografice. Se întâmplă că utilizarea VPN poate fi determinată analizând conexiunea TCP în funcție de dimensiunea MTU. Poate fi evitată această situație? Să spunem imediat: cu VPN de la - poți!

Vă recomandăm să utilizați , deoarece clientul nostru VPN vă permite să schimbați MTU cu un singur clic. În plus, clientul nostru VPN are și alte avantaje, cum ar fi accesul simultan de pe mai multe dispozitive, canale de comunicare fiabile și fără limite de viteză.

Să începem cu detaliile tehnice. Cum poate fi determinată utilizarea unui VPN?

Valoarea MTU

Maximum Transmission Unit, sau pe scurt MTU, este cantitatea maximă de informații transmise trimise într-un pachet de date. Parametrul MTU este atribuit interfețelor de rețea. Valoarea MTU implicită pentru o conexiune prin cablu este 1500. O valoare MTU de 1500 înseamnă că cantitatea de date transferată prin conexiune nu poate depăși 1500 de octeți.

În majoritatea cazurilor, valoarea parametrului MTU pentru VPN este 1450. Dar, de exemplu, pentru implementarea OpenVPN, în funcție de protocolul de conexiune, algoritmul de criptare a traficului, algoritmul de verificare a integrității și utilizarea compresiei, MTU este setat la o dimensiune non-standard, pe baza căreia acești parametri pot fi obținuți, precum și determină însuși faptul de a utiliza OpenVPN.

Cum să evitați detectarea VPN

Pentru a face acest lucru, trebuie să modificați manual dimensiunea MTU. Dacă nu doriți să fiți deanonimizat prin detectarea unui MTU non-standard, puteți seta manual „mssfix 0” pe server și „mssfix 0” pe client, care va seta parametrul MTU la 1500. Cu toate acestea, când utilizați UDP , vă recomandăm să setați „mssfix 1330” în configurația clientului.

  • Serghei Savenkov

    un fel de recenzie „rare”... parcă s-ar grăbi undeva